ITPub博客

首页 > Linux操作系统 > Linux操作系统 > [zt] 收集基于成本的优化统计数据 - 分区表

[zt] 收集基于成本的优化统计数据 - 分区表

原创 Linux操作系统 作者:tolywang 时间:2009-06-03 14:10:04 0 删除 编辑

http://tech.it168.com/a2008/1226/261/000000261354.shtml    

GATHER_TABLE_STATS

  收集表、列和索引统计数据。

<!--

Code highlighting produced by Actipro CodeHighlighter (freeware)
http://www.CodeHighlighter.com/

-->SQL> execute dbms_stats.gather_table_stats(-

  
>ownname => 'test',-

  
>tabname => 'PARTTAB',-

  
>partname => null,- --> 收集所有分区状态

  
>estimate_percent => null,- --> 计算模式

  
>block_sample => false,- --> 默认值,计算模式下无意义

  
>method_opt => 'FOR ALL COLUMNS SIZE 1',- --> 表和列统计,不生成直方图

  
>degree => null,- --> 基于PARTTAB表上的DOP设置的默认并行度

  
>granularity => 'default',- -->收集全局和分区统计数据

  
>cascade => true ,- --> 产生所有统计数据

  
>stattab => null,- -->统计数据将被存储在字典中

  
>statid => null,-

  
>statown => null);

 

 

来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/35489/viewspace-608031/,如需转载,请注明出处,否则将追究法律责任。

请登录后发表评论 登录
全部评论
Oracle , MySQL, SAP IQ, SAP HANA, PostgreSQL, Tableau 技术讨论,希望在这里一起分享知识,讨论技术,畅谈人生 。

注册时间:2007-12-10

  • 博文量
    5595
  • 访问量
    13203068